sinat_30443713
sinat_30443713
采纳率0%
2017-06-06 08:54 浏览 1.7k

unity中使用sqlite报错CreateCommand (): IL_0000: ret

unity中总是报错Invalid IL code in Mono.Data.Sqlite.Sqli teConnection:CreateCommand (): IL_0000: ret 项目文件夹下没有成功创建出数据库文件,各种办法试了还是报错,求哪位大神告知

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

2条回答 默认 最新

  • roy826 roy826 2017-11-24 07:59

    我也遇到这个问题了 楼主解决了吗
    尝试了更换sqlite3.dll也不行

    点赞 评论 复制链接分享
  • roy826 roy826 2017-11-24 08:14

    问题解决了
    Mono.Data.Sqlite.dll和System.Data.dll用错了
    参考http://blog.csdn.net/tang908452747/article/details/72847916
    我之前是用的C:\Program Files (x86)\Reference Assemblies\Microsoft\Framework.NETFramework\v3.5\Profile\Unity Full v3.5路径下的dll
    换成C:\Program Files\Unity\Editor\Data\Mono\lib\mono\2.0下的dll之后好了
    原因是unity3D是用.net Framework2.0 而我之前用的dll是3.5的

    点赞 评论 复制链接分享

相关推荐